St. Croix Lutheran fends off Fairmont at BLC Invite

MANKATO – The Fairmont Cardinals boys basketball team rallied to outscore the Class 2A, No. 19-ranked St. Croix Lutheran Crusaders, 26-18, during the final 18 minutes of Tuesday night’s first-round game of the Pepsi/Bethany Lutheran College Holiday Invitational in Mankato.

Unfortunately for the Cardinals, junior guard Jack Kuckhahn scored a co-game-best 17 points, and junior forward Adam Arroyo chipped in 13 points to help St. Croix Lutheran fend off Fairmont, 50-42, at Younge Gym.

Fairmont (1-5) faces the Le Sueur-Henderson Giants (1-7) in one of the holiday tournament’s consolation semifinal games at 6 p.m. tonight back at Younge Gym.

The Class 2A, No. 16-ranked New Richland-Hartland-Ellendale-Geneva Panthers coasted to a 76-52 opening-round triumph over Le Sueur-Henderson on Tuesday night in Mankato.

New Richland-Hartland-Ellendale-Geneva (6-0) takes on St. Croix Lutheran (4-3) at 6:30 p.m. tonight in one of the eight-team invite’s championship semifinals in the North Gym on the Bethany Lutheran College campus.

The Crusaders built a 32-16 halftime advantage over the Cardinals before head coach Jared Thompson’s lineup assembled a second-half comeback that whittled its deficit under double figures.

Junior post player Derek Missling produced a co-game-leading 17 points to help ignite Fairmont’s second-half rally.

Senior center Walker Tordsen neared double-double territory by scoring eight points to complement garnering eight rebounds for the Cardinals.

Junior guard Nate Kallenbach contributed seven points, distributed three assists and pocketed three steals for Fairmont.

The Cardinals connected on 11 of 15 free throws for 73.3 percent, made 11 of 31 shots from 2-point territory for 35.5 percent and sank 3 of 11 attempts from behind the 3-point arc for 27.3 percent on the game.

St. Croix Lutheran sank 9 of 14 free throws for 64.3 percent, connected on 13 of 23 shots from 2-point range for 56.5 percent and added 5-for-22 shooting from behind the 3-point line for 22.7 percent.

In the other half of the Pepsi/BLC Holiday Invitational, Class 1A, No. 19-ranked Minnesota Valley Lutheran flattened St. Clair, 77-47, while Class 2A, No. 19-rated Maple River downed Lake Crystal-Wellcome Memorial, 65-49.

MVL (6-1) plays Maple River (6-2) at 8:30 p.m. tonight, while St. Clair (3-3) faces LCWM (2-5) at 8 p.m.
